自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(29)
  • 资源 (15)
  • 收藏
  • 关注

原创 控件基类及属性

3个基类的继承层次结构:System.Windows.UIElementSystem.Windows.FrameworkElementSystem.Windows.Controls.ControlUIElement类常用属性:AllowDrop 获取或设置一个值,该值确定此 UIElement 是否可用作拖放操作的放置目标。CacheMode 获取或设置一个值,

2013-12-07 20:01:49 720

转载 C#中readonly关键字与const关键字的区别

const 的概念就是一个包含不能修改的值的变量。常数表达式是在编译时可被完全计算的表达式。因此不能从一个变量中提取的值来初始化常量。如果 const int a = b+1;b是一个变量,显然不能在编译时就计算出结果,所以常量是不可以用变量来初始化的。readonly 允许把一个字段设置成常量,但可以执行一些运算,可以确定它的初始值。因为 readonly 是在计算时执行的,当然它可

2013-12-02 11:08:01 565

原创 WPF之动画

线性关键帧、不连续关键帧动画: <PointAnimationUsingKeyFrames Storyboard.TargetName="ellipse" Storyboard.TargetProperty="Fill.

2013-12-01 20:31:49 1185

原创 WPF之动画

样式动画: <DoubleAnimation Storyboard.TargetProperty

2013-11-30 23:23:17 827

原创 WPF之效果

模糊效果: 灰色效果:

2013-11-30 19:45:34 1846

原创 WPF之绘图

点线: <Polyline Stroke="Blue" StrokeThickness="10" StrokeDashArray="1 2" Points="10,30 60,0 90,40

2013-11-30 09:20:08 763

原创 WPF之样式

自动样式: Customized Button Normal Content. <Button Padding="5" Margin="5" Style="{x:Null}" >A Normal Button More normal Content.

2013-11-29 22:01:28 542

原创 WPF之资源

<ImageBrush x:Key="{ComponentResourceKey TypeInTargetAssembly={x:Type local:CustomResources}, ResourceId=SadTileBrush}" TileMode="Tile" ViewportUnits="Absolute" Viewport="0 0 32 32"

2013-11-28 23:03:37 601

原创 WPF之命令

Requery public partial class CustomCommand : System.Windows.Window { public CustomCommand() { InitializeComponent(); } private void RequeryCommand(

2013-11-28 22:23:41 690

原创 WPF之自定义控件

public class CommandSlider : Slider, ICommandSource { public CommandSlider() : base() { } //ICommand Interface Memembers //make Command a depe

2013-11-28 22:14:56 993

转载 一个Metro风格的开源项目 MahApps.Metro

目录:Metro风格控件Metro主题 MahApps.Metro文档地址:http://mahapps.com/MahApps.Metro/源码地址:https://github.com/MahApps/MahApps.Metro在VS中可以装一个NuGet插件来下载MahApps.Metro.dll和MahApps.Metro.Resources.dll。M

2013-11-27 17:59:58 2787

原创 WPF之绑定

绑定字体: Calibri 元素之间绑定: <TextBlock Margin="10" Name="lblSampleText" FontSize="{Binding ElementName=sliderFont

2013-11-24 21:58:00 815

原创 WPF之菜单选择-反射

private void ButtonClick(object sender, RoutedEventArgs e) { // Get the current button. Button cmd = (Button)e.OriginalSource;

2013-11-24 21:49:04 1153

原创 WPF之窗体追踪

public partial class App : Application { private List documents = new List(); public List Documents { get { return documents; } set { docum

2013-11-24 21:41:57 790

原创 WPF之单例模式

public class Startup { [STAThread] public static void Main(string[] args) { SingleInstanceApplicationWrapper wrapper = new SingleInstanceApplication

2013-11-24 21:36:47 3592

原创 WPF之任务结束

public partial class App : Application { private bool unsavedData = false; public bool UnsavedData { get { return unsavedData; } set { unsavedData =

2013-11-24 21:32:03 645

原创 WPF之运行参数

public partial class App : Application { // The command-line argument is set through the Visual Studio // project properties (the Debug tab). private void App_Startup(objec

2013-11-24 21:29:01 644

原创 WPF之应用程序资源

Play private void cmdPlay_Click(object sender, RoutedEventArgs e) { img.Source = new BitmapImage(new Uri("images/winter.jpg", UriKind.Relati

2013-11-24 21:25:54 496

原创 WPF之检测鼠标位置

Capture the Mouse private void cmdCapture_Click(object sender, RoutedEventArgs e) { this.AddHandler( Mouse.LostMouseCaptureEvent,

2013-11-24 19:03:50 1123

原创 WPF之按键事件

Type here: <TextBox PreviewKeyDown="KeyEvent" KeyDown="KeyEvent" PreviewKeyUp="KeyEvent" KeyUp="KeyEvent" PreviewTextInput="TextInpu

2013-11-24 18:59:26 4067

原创 WPF之功能键检测

Check Current Shift State private void KeyEvent(object sender, KeyEventArgs e) { lblInfo.Text = "Modifiers: " + e.KeyboardDevice.Modifiers.To

2013-11-24 18:53:59 736

原创 WPF之鼠标拖放复制

Drag from this TextBox <Label Grid.Column="1" Padding="20" Background="LightGoldenrodYellow" VerticalAlignment="Center" HorizontalAlignment="Center" MouseDown="lblSource_Mo

2013-11-24 18:49:33 887

原创 WPF之路由事件

路由规则之冒泡规则:<Window x:Class="RoutedEvents.BubbledLabelClick"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" Title=

2013-11-24 18:45:19 816

原创 WPF之布局控件

StackPanel:堆栈面板 A Button Stack Button 1 Button 2 Button 3 Button 4 <CheckBox Name="chkVertical" Margin="10" HorizontalAlignment="Center" Checked="chkVertica

2013-11-24 18:26:22 997

原创 WPF 自下定义多指针标尺

Window2.xaml:        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"        xmlns:local="clr-namespace:Test" 

2013-11-24 13:17:54 3413

原创 WPF美女时钟

改自网页版的美女时钟MainWindow.xaml:<Window x:Class="Clock.MainWindow" x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/

2013-11-24 13:10:37 891

原创 WPF版会飞的小鸟

用Blend画界面、做动画,C#控件位移。MainWindow.xaml:<Window x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ation" x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ml" xm

2013-11-24 13:06:16 781

原创 MVVM模式基于开源VLC解码器WPF万能视频播放器

采用VLC解码器,能播放市面上几乎所有格式影片。Models:SysInfo.csusing System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;namespace MvvmPlayer.Models{ pu

2013-11-24 12:46:25 10827 4

原创 MVVM模式WPF计算器

采用MvvmLight工具构建的计算器Models:CalculationModel.cs

2013-11-24 12:19:18 3220 1

Rust编程之道PDF

Rust 是一门利用现代化的类型系统,有机地融合了内存管理、所有权语义和混合编程范式的编程语 言。它不仅能科学地保证程序的正确性,还能保证内存安全和线程安全。同时,还有能与 C/C++语言媲 美的性能,以及能和动态语言媲美的开发效率。 本书并非对语法内容进行简单罗列讲解,而是从四个维度深入全面且通透地介绍了 Rust 语言。从设 计哲学出发,探索 Rust 语言的内在一致性;从源码分析入手,探索 Rust 地道的编程风格;从工程角度着 手,探索 Rust 对健壮性的支持;从底层原理开始,探索 Rust 内存安全的本质。

2019-05-05

Advanced_Installer14.3汉化破解版

Advanced_Installer14.3汉化破解版,内含安装程序和汉化破解补丁,亲测可用。

2017-12-08

Docker进阶与实战

Docker进阶与实战.华为Docker实践小组,完全扫描版

2017-08-29

Ceph Cookbook 中文版

Ceph 存储系统 权威手册

2017-07-17

Kubernetes权威指南 第2版

Kubernetes权威指南 第2版

2017-07-03

zprotect 1.6 专业注册版

zprotect 1.6 专业注册版,亲测可用,但anti插件,360会误报病毒,添加安全即可。

2017-07-02

CheckComboBox/RadioComboBox/ListBoxComboBox

CheckComboBox RadioComboBox ListBoxComboBox 可直接使用

2014-09-03

WPF标尺控件

WPF自定义标尺控件,支持多Thumb,可以直接用在项目上。

2013-11-14

WPF画刷编辑器控件

WPF画刷编辑器,就是VS或者Blend的画刷编辑器。

2013-11-14

VisualSVN 3.6 破解支持VS2013+WIN8.1

VisualSVN 3.6 破解,把两文件复制到目录覆盖,支持VS2013+WIN8.1 亲测可用,请放心使用。

2013-10-18

Blend4 Wpf设计基础

Blend4 Wpf设计基础,顶好的教程,我找了好几天才找着的,整体源码。

2013-05-28

Vala教程中文翻译

vala初步翻译教程,没有时间整理,哪位仁兄有兴趣可以整理一下。

2011-08-22

Exploring Expect

expect教程书,关注expect的书就两本,一体expect,一本exploring expect,此书是第一版,也是绝版,此PDF为完整版,无缺页

2010-03-24

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除